True Leadership Begins When You Stop Carrying It All Alone

Leadership isn’t about doing it all - it’s about building a team that thrives.

“The first rule of management is delegation. Don’t try and do everything yourself because you can’t.” - Anthea Turner

You didn’t step into leadership to carry it all on your shoulders.
You stepped into leadership to lift others while guiding the vision.

But that can only happen when you let go of the fear that says:

- “If I don’t do it, it won’t be done right.”
- “What if someone outshines me?”
- “I can’t trust anyone else to carry this.”

These limiting beliefs don’t just weigh you down - they hold your team back.
They rob them of growth, trust, and confidence.

True leadership is about creating an environment where people feel safe to step up, take ownership, and shine.

It’s in that safety that innovation happens.

It’s in that safety that real teams are built.

- When you trust yourself, you’ll trust your team.
- When you stop competing, you’ll start collaborating.
- When you lead from security, you’ll inspire it in others.
